what is the volume of a rectangle with a height of 11 inches a length of 15 inches and width of 7 inches

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-04-2020

Step-by-step explanation:

Height (h) = 11 inch

Length (L) = 15 inch

width (b) = 7 inch

Volume

= l * b *h

= 15 * 7 * 11

= 1155 inch ³
